Multiple small grants have been awarded to Buffalo, New York, area organizations through the New York Great Lakes Basin Small Grants Program. The projects aim to promote sustainable land use, improve water quality and manage natural resources using ecosystem-based approaches. Read the full story by Buffalo Rising.
